Yes, it is possible to open a merchant account if you are in ChexSystems, but it may be more challenging. Many payment processors conduct background checks through ChexSystems, and a negative report could lead to denial. However, some providers specialize in working with high-risk businesses or those with poor banking histories. It's advisable to research options and consider alternative providers that may be more flexible.

Does capital one use chexsystems?

Yes, Capital One does use ChexSystems as part of its account approval process. ChexSystems is a reporting agency that tracks consumer banking behaviors, including overdrafts and account closures. If you have negative entries in your ChexSystems report, it may impact your ability to open a new account with Capital One. Always check your ChexSystems report for accuracy before applying for a bank account.


Does PNC Bank use ChexSystems?

Yes, PNC Bank does use ChexSystems as part of its account opening process. ChexSystems is a consumer reporting agency that provides information on an individual's banking history, including any negative records such as overdrafts or unpaid fees. This information helps PNC assess the risk of opening an account for a potential customer. If you have a negative record with ChexSystems, it may impact your ability to open an account at PNC Bank.

Can you open a savings account if you are on ChexSystems?

Opening A Savings AccountGenerally if a bank uses chexsystems, they will use it to open a savings as well. Sometimes a credit union will open a savings account if you are on chexsystems as long as you are eligible for a membership even if they will not open a checking. Some banks and credit unions do not verify savings accounts through chexsystems so it really depends on the bank or credit union .Right now ING direct is an excellent place if you are looking for a savings ONLY. How can you check to see if you will have a problem with chexsystems?

To check if you might have a problem with ChexSystems, you can request a free copy of your ChexSystems report, which you are entitled to once a year under the Fair Credit Reporting Act. Review the report for any negative entries, such as unpaid debts or account closures. Additionally, you can contact banks or credit unions to inquire about their policies regarding ChexSystems and how it may affect your ability to open a new account.

Can you open a business bank account for your newly formed LLC if you are in chex system for a personal account?

It depends on the bank ..many banks will only run the LLC or Corp name through chexsystems and not the signers. Other banks may not use chexsystems at all
